NFL game summary for 12/17/1978:



Ken Anderson threw two touchdown passes and Pete Johnson rushed for a team record 160 yards as the Bengals erupted for their biggest point total of the season. Cincinnati converted two second quarter fumble recoveries into a 23-yard field goal by Chris Bahr and a 40-yard touchdown pass from Anderson to Don Bass. Greg Pruitt led a mild Cleveland rally with a 70-yard touchdown run on the way to a career high 182-yard day. The Bengals put the game out of reach in the fourth quarter by scoring 24 points. Cincinnati's Pat McInally won his first NFL punting title (43.1) and Cleveland's Thom Darden posted an NFL-high 10 interceptions for the season.
